Abstract
SUMMARYRecently, improvement in power saving and cost efficiency by monitoring the operation status of various facilities over the network has gained attention. A wireless network, especially a cellular network, has advantages in mobility, coverage, and scalability. On the other hand, it has the disadvantage of low reliability, due to rapid changes in the available bandwidth. We propose a transmission control scheme based on data priority and instantaneous available bandwidth to realize a highly reliable remote monitoring system via a cellular network. We have developed our proposed monitoring system and evaluated the effectiveness of our scheme, and proved it reduces the maximum transmission delay of sensor status to 1/10 compared to best‐effort transmission. © 2013 Wiley Periodicals, Inc.
